Sen. Gary Peters (D-Mich.) led a Senate Homeland Security Committee hearing on cybersecurity challenges to the U.S. health care system on Thursday.

Peters recalled a catastrophic ransom attack in Mobile, Alabama, in 2019. “The attack prevented health care providers from using an equipment to monitor a baby’s condition during delivery. And as a result, the infant tragically passed away,” he said.
